The Fall of the House of Usher (traducido en español como La Caída de la Casa Usher) es una miniserie de televisión por internet estadounidense de drama y terror gótico, creada por Mike Flanagan. Está basada en el cuento del mismo nombre y otras obras de Edgar Allan Poe. Se estrenó en Netflix el 12 de octubre de 2023. [1]

  3. The Fall of the House of Usher is an American gothic horror drama television miniseries created by Mike Flanagan. All eight episodes were released on Netflix on October 12, 2023, each directed by either Flanagan or Michael Fimognari, with the latter also acting as cinematographer for the entire series.

The Fall of the House of Usher is an opera composed by Peter Hammill with a libretto by Chris Judge Smith released in 1991 on Some Bizzare Records; in 1999, Hammill revised his work and released it as The Fall of the House of Usher (Deconstructed & Rebuilt). This opera has never been performed live.
